Ingredients
- 2 medium ripe avocados
- 4 slices Texas toast or bread of your choice
- Butter
- Lime juice
- Cheese
- Salt
- Pepper
Instructions
- In a bowl add sliced avocado and toss with lime juice, salt and pepper.
- Assemble sandwich, layer 1 slice bread with one slice of cheese, add avocado slices and top with cheese and remaining slice of bread.
- Heat 1 tablespoon of butter in a nonstick skillet over medium – low heat.
- Add sandwich to pan. Cook until cheese melts and bread is golden in color. About 3 minutes each side.
